Raising Cane’s Chicken Finger Sauce Recipe

This recipe recreates the iconic Raising Cane’s Chicken Finger Sauce, a creamy, tangy, and slightly spicy dip perfect for chicken fingers, fries, or snacks. With just a handful of common ingredients, you can whip up this delicious sauce at home to elevate your meals.

Ingredients

  • 1 cup mayonnaise (Hellmann’s or Duke’s for an authentic touch)
  • 1/2 cup Heinz ketchup
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per


Instructions

  1. Combine ingredients: In a small bowl, add the mayonnaise, ketchup, Worcestershire sauce, garlic powder, salt, and freshly ground black pepper.
  2. Mix thoroughly: Use a whisk or spoon to blend all the ingredients together until the sauce is smooth and evenly mixed.
  3. Refrigerate: Transfer the sauce into a tightly sealed container and chill it in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ours to allow the flavors to meld.
  4. Serve: Once chilled, serve the sauce alongside chicken fingers, fries, or your favorite snacks for a tasty dipping experience.

Notes

  • For best flavor, refrigerate the sauce for at least 2 hours before serving.
  • Adjust the amount of black pepper to taste for more or less spiciness.
  • This sauce keeps well for up to a week when stored properly in the refrigerator.
  • Use real mayonnaise brands like Hellmann’s or Duke’s for an authentic taste.
